Shield, Eye, Radiological
A radiological eye shield is a small lead or radiation-attenuating protective device placed over or near the eyes during radiological procedures to reduce radiation dose to the ocular lens, which is particularly sensitive to radiation-induced injury. It is classified as FDA Class 1, the lowest risk category, subject only to general controls. The product code is IWS, regulated under 21 CFR 892.6500, within the Radiology medical specialty.

510(k) Clearance History
Related 510(k) Clearances
This FDA classification is associated with 6 510(k) clearances via K numbers.
| K Number | Device Name | Decision Date | Decision | Applicant |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| K945515 | COATED TUNGSTEN EYESHIELD | Jun 19, 1995 | Substantially Equivalent | Medtec, Inc. |
| K940119 | ROYAL MARSDEN GOLD GRAIN GUN | Dec 30, 1994 | Substantially Equivalent | Best Industries |
| K943011 | TUNGSTEN EYESHIELD | Dec 23, 1994 | Substantially Equivalent | Medtec, Inc. |
| K934459 | MED-GENESIS PATIENT LASER EYE SHIELD | Feb 22, 1994 | Substantially Equivalent | Med-Genesis, Inc. |
| K934362 | NUCLEAR ASSOCIATES GLASSERS | Nov 12, 1993 | Substantially Equivalent | Victoreen, Inc. |
| K920540 | RADIOLOGICAL PROTECTIVE EYE SHIELD | May 28, 1992 | Substantially Equivalent | Burkhart Roentgen Intl., Inc. |
